Explore Vancouver, WA: Uncover Beauty, History, and Community

What is Vancouver WA Known For: Spacious suburban house on a sunny day.

Discover What Makes Vancouver, WA, a Hidden Gem

Vancouver, Washington, is a city that captures the hearts of many with its vibrant history, stunning natural landscapes, and engaging community. Located just north of Portland, Oregon, it has earned a reputation as a desirable place for homeowners and real estate seekers alike, thanks to its blend of urban amenities and outdoor pleasures.

Majestic Waterfront Along the Columbia River

One of Vancouver’s standout features is the breathtaking waterfront that stretches along the Columbia River. Residents and visitors are drawn to the Waterfront Renaissance Trail, a scenic pathway that offers panoramic views of the river and the majestic Mount Hood. Areas like Grant Street Pier are perfect spots to unwind, providing a place to relax while soaking in the fresh air and stunning views. Paths lined with trees, benches, and art installations make this area a beloved haven for fitness enthusiasts, families, and anyone looking to connect with nature.

Historic Officer’s Row: A Walk Through History

History buffs and architecture lovers find joy in visiting Officer's Row, a collection of historic homes dating back to the 19th century. Originally built for army officers stationed at Fort Vancouver, these beautifully restored homes now serve as a reminder of the area’s military past. Tours allow you to appreciate not only the architecture but also the rich stories that each home holds. This landmark is a crucial piece of Vancouver’s cultural puzzles, demonstrating the city's commitment to preserving its heritage.

Thriving Arts and Culture Scene

Vancouver prides itself on a vibrant arts scene that melds the contemporary with the traditional. Local galleries showcase creations from emerging artists, while various festivals and cultural events celebrate the community's diversity. The First Friday Art Walk, for instance, draws residents and art lovers together to explore local exhibitions, making it easy to support artists while enjoying a night out. This dynamic atmosphere fosters creativity and community spirit, making Vancouver a perfect destination for those who value artistic expression.

Outdoor Activities and Natural Wonders

The abundance of outdoor activities in Vancouver is another compelling reason to consider moving to this breathtaking area. With numerous parks, such as Esther Short Park and Washington State Parks, residents can enjoy hiking, biking, and soaking up nature’s beauty right in their backyard. Vancouver also offers easy access to the stunning Pacific Northwest’s natural wonders, including mountains, forests, and rivers. For lovers of the outdoors, this access is invaluable, allowing for spontaneous adventures throughout the year.

Community Spirit and Friendly Neighbors

At its core, Vancouver fosters a strong sense of community. Local events, such as farmers' markets and music festivals, provide opportunities for neighbors to connect and form lasting friendships. The welcoming atmosphere here is palpable, making it easy for newcomers to feel at home. From community outreach programs to volunteer opportunities, residents embrace the idea of coming together to support one another and enhance their community spirit.

Key Areas Where Mold Grows in a House: Ensure Your Home's Safety

Update Understanding Mold Growth in Your Home Mold is more than just an unsightly nuisance; it can significantly impact your health and home environment. The growing concern about air quality and the increasing awareness of health issues associated with mold make it essential for homeowners and prospective buyers to understand where mold typically thrives in their homes. This article dives deep into common areas where mold tends to flourish, why it occurs, and how you can successfully mitigate its presence. What Causes Mold to Develop? At its core, mold thrives in damp conditions, making moisture its primary instigator. Certified professionals highlight that mold spores are everywhere, but they need a wet environment to grow and multiply. According to Jennifer, a Certified Biotoxin Assessor, “Mold in the home is primarily caused by excess moisture, which can result from leaks, high humidity, poor ventilation, or water intrusion.” It only takes between 24 to 48 hours of dampness for mold to take hold, turning a minor issue into a significant problem. Therefore, identifying potential trouble spots in your home is crucial for proactive prevention. Common Areas Where Mold Grows in Homes Becoming familiar with common mold-prone areas can empower homeowners to act before mold develops uncontrollably. Here are some primary suspect locations: 1. Basements and Crawlspaces Indubitably, basements are notorious for mold growth due to their inherent darkness and moisture. Experienced mold experts confirm that any dampness—be it leaks or humidity—can create favorable conditions for mold spores to flourish. Proper ventilation combined with a dehumidifier can help keep mold at bay. 2. Bathrooms and Kitchens These rooms see regular moisture. Mold can grow in hard-to-reach areas, from behind toilets to inside cabinets. Installing ventilation fans and opening windows during and after showers can significantly reduce steam and moisture buildup. Regular cleaning of surfaces can also thwart growth in these areas. 3. Attics and HVAC Systems Attics often have limited airflow. Forgotten leaks from the roof or moisture trapped in ductwork can lead to mold without you even realizing it. Periodic inspections of these areas are vital, as mold in the attic can spread to living spaces through ventilation systems. 4. Around Plumbing Fixtures Areas around sinks, showers, and dishwashers are prime locations for mold, especially those hidden behind cabinets where slow leaks might occur. Regularly checking for any leaks and promptly addressing them can help keep these areas mold-free. 5. Laundry Rooms The laundry area is another often-overlooked mold habitat. Drying wet clothing indoors can raise humidity levels, promoting mold growth. Ensure proper ventilation and quickly address spills from the washer or dryer to minimize water presence. Proactive Steps to Keep Your Home Mold-Free It's essential to take proactive measures to minimize mold growth. Here are several recommendations to consider: Regularly inspect high-risk areas: Make routine checks of high moisture areas (basements, bathrooms, kitchens) a part of your maintenance schedule. Maintain proper ventilation: Use exhaust fans and open windows during showers and cooking to allow steam to escape. Utilize dehumidifiers: In humid climates, using dehumidifiers in basements and other susceptible areas can significantly reduce moisture levels. Repair leaks immediately: Don’t delay fixing any leaks in bathrooms, kitchens, and plumbing fixtures. Opt for mold-resistant materials: When renovating or building, consider using materials specifically designed to resist mold growth. Essential Fire Prevention Tips for Homeowners in 2026

Update Understanding the Risks of Home Fires Home fires are a significant threat to safety, with countless tragedies arising from preventable causes. From unattended stoves to faulty wiring, these incidents often start from simple, overlooked mistakes. Many homeowners, renters, or prospective buyers may not fully grasp the scale of the risks involved. Understanding common causes of fires is the first step in fire prevention, leading to improved safety and peace of mind. Everyday Habits to Protect Your Home Creating a fire-safe home doesn't have to be overwhelming. By incorporating a few simple habits into everyday life, the risks can be substantially reduced. Here are some of the most crucial practices: Regularly Test and Maintain Smoke Alarms: Smoke alarms are your first line of defense. It's critical to test them monthly and replace batteries as needed. Installing them on every level and particularly inside bedrooms can save lives. Be Cautious with Charging Devices: Always charge lithium-powered devices in a well-ventilated area and avoid overnight charging. This simple adjustment can prevent overheating and potential fires. Cooking with Care: Unattended cooking is one of the leading causes of house fires. Stay vigilant while cooking and keep a fire extinguisher within reach in the kitchen. Hidden Electrical Hazards Electrical hazards are often stealthy, bearing the potential to start dangerous fires. Pay attention to signs such as warm or discolored outlets, flickering lights, and frequent tripping of circuit breakers. Addressing these signals with professional help can drastically reduce fire risks, ensuring the safety of your loved ones and home. Implementing a Fire Escape Plan In the event a fire does occur, preparation is key. Establish a fire escape plan that outlines clear routes for every member of the family, especially those with mobility challenges. Regular drills can help ensure everyone knows what to do in a crisis, effectively minimizing panic and maximizing safety. Investing in Fire Safety Equipment Choosing the right equipment can make a world of difference. Options like dual smoke and carbon monoxide detectors offer enhanced protection. Installing these devices strategically can alert you to smoke or gas dangers before they escalate. Modern smart alarms can even send notifications directly to your smartphone, providing real-time awareness and control.
